Okay that sounds good. Picking them off one by one will work well, just when you turn the corner, try to get some of the grenadiers and vets to pull them back to the NPCs right before the bridge. Once you have most of those, run as fast as you can pass the rest and head up to the stairs around the bend. Pull one by one for the remainder there and pull them up the stairs and next to the guards with the giant shields and swords, they help out immensely. If you manage to move all enemies away from the caravan, it will auto complete the mission for you. I was still fighting the vet, and it said I got the achievement and I was like, wow! Finally! LoL.
